Ed Massey to serve as new Sail America president

MIDDLETOWN, R.I. – The Sail America Board of Directors has elected Ed Massey, founder of Massey Yacht Sales & Service, as Sail America’s new president, the association reported in its newsletter.

Linda Klockner, marketing communications director for Sail Magazine, has been reelected to her second term as a Sail America board member and is the new treasurer. Bill Bolin, Island Packet’s director of sales and marketing, is the new vice president of the National Boat Show Committee.

Returning vice presidents are Sally Helme, publisher of Sailing World and Cruising World, who chairs the Marketing Committee and Harry Munns, a founder and executive vice president of the American Sailing Association, who chairs the Association Committee.

New board members are Walt Brown, founder of Layline, and George Day, the publisher and editor of Blue Water Sailing magazine.
